[QUOTE="Alphathon, post: 915086, member: 105814"] That's something else I should probably have mentioned: recordings still play fine when this happens as far as I can tell. I only really use the TV portion of MP, so I don't know if other parts also function properly. That's a shame. I don't use CRC check as it is. I'll do what I can, assuming it is a deadlock problem. As for frequency, I've never had it manifest more than once a day to my knowledge (although I don't normally notice until I see a scheduled recording in the EPG which should be recording "now" but isn't; I watch most of my TV after the fact), and it happens maybe 4 days a week, although that's a [I]very[/I] rough guess. In my case I wouldn't be at all surprised if it's related to mysql timeouts, since I've had quite a few of those since installing my sat card (presumably due to the database roughly trebling in size), in fact, I had to set WebEPG to export to XMLTV rather than writing to the database itself since the built in one didn't seem to be able to handle it (worked fine before when only 4 channels were being imported, but now I have ≈100 14 day listings, although many of those are duplicated for regional channel variations).
